Responsibilities: Audit financial statements, quarterly financial information, and clients' annual reports. Take part in pre-audit planning to assess the risk of material misstatement of financial accounts to design effective audit procedures. Identify accounting and audit issues and perform research to solve issues. Responsible for testing internal controls, policies, and procedures and making recommendations. Perform audits under Generally Accepted Auditing Standards (GAAS),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P), Public Company Accounting Oversight Board (PCAOB), American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A) auditing standards, and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X). Proactively build relationships and communicate with clients and associates. Teach, train, and develop incoming staff/interns. Qualifications:
